When searching to extend your SketchUp functionalities, you can explore two different sources of plugins:
The first source, the official SketchUp Extensions Warehouse, offers several advantages, including a wide variety of extensions conveniently available in one place. Additionally, the SketchUp team ensures a high level of quality and compatibility for these plugins. However, it's worth noting that not all developers choose to publish their plugins on the Extensions Warehouse. This leads us to the second source: developers' websites. By exploring these websites, you can discover software tools that may not be showcased anywhere else. Furthermore, downloading an extension directly from its developer provides the added benefit of receiving full support and assistance, including licensing matters. So, whether you prefer the convenience of the Extensions Warehouse or the unique offerings from developers' websites, both sources provide valuable options to expand your SketchUp capabilities. Extension Warehouse
The Extension Warehouse on the official
SketchUp website is a centralized location where users can browse, download, and install a wide variety
of extensions. These extensions are created by both SketchUp and third-party developers and have been
tested and approved by SketchUp to ensure they are compatible with the software. The Extension Warehouse
offers a wide range of extensions to suit different needs and skill levels. Some of the most popular
categories include architectural design, interior design, landscaping, and woodworking.
Additionally, the Extension Warehouse allows users to filter and search for extensions based on specific
features, making it easy to find the right extension for your needs. Users can also see user ratings and
reviews, which can provide valuable insights into how well the extension works, and whether it is
suitable for their needs.
Another useful feature of the Extension Warehouse is that it allows users to keep track of the
extensions they have installed, as well as any updates available. This ensures that the extensions are
always up-to-date and can take advantage of the latest features and bug fixes.
The official SketchUp website's Extension Warehouse is an essential resource for anyone looking to
enhance the functionality of their SketchUp software. With a wide range of extensions available, from
architectural design tools to interior design and landscaping tools, users can easily find and install
the extensions they need to improve their workflow and productivity.
Extension developers site
In addition to the official Extension Warehouse, searching for SketchUp extensions on
the developer's websites can also be a great way to find additional tools and resources. By visiting the
websites of specific developers, you can often find more information about their extensions, including
detailed descriptions, tutorials, and even video demonstrations. This can help you understand the full
capabilities of the extension, and how it can be used to improve your workflow.
Furthermore, many developers offer additional programs and tools that are compatible with SketchUp.
These can include complementary extensions, as well as standalone programs that work in conjunction with
SketchUp. This can greatly enhance the functionality and capabilities of the software. Some examples are
rendering engines, animation tools, or BIM tools.
Additionally, by visiting the developer's website, you can also find out if they offer customer support
and updates, which can be important when working with extensions.
In conclusion, visiting the developer's websites can be a valuable resource for finding SketchUp
extensions and additional tools. It can provide more information, tutorials, and complementary programs,
which can help you make the most out of the software.
